Following last month's approval in principle, we have completed site selection in the Tarvene Corridor. Two distribution hubs are under option, and local licensing is progressing on schedule. Initial staffing will draw from the Ellsmark office, with regional hires beginning in month three. Projected break-even is eighteen months, consistent with the Norrel expansion. Risks remain currency exposure and one pending zoning decision. We will circulate the full investment memo ahead of the vote. The confidential strategic summary appears below.

internal memo for yahaf-hawif: The finance team signed off on a budget of $59.9 million for Project Rusax.

Handover note — Crumbwheel order cutoffs.

Welcome aboard. The bakery cutoff rule in Crumbwheel closes same-day orders at 14:00 local to each storefront, not UTC — this has bitten us twice. Holiday overrides live in the calendar service and take precedence silently, so always check there first when a cutoff looks wrong. To unlock the calendar service's admin console after a restart, enter the recovery passphrase below.

vault phrase of bagap-bahaf = silion-pelox-sorox-casdor-quenwyn-fraax-eliox-praael-kelion-quenvan-kasox-rusael-norius-belvan

Minutes — Management Meeting, Brellanto Software

Present: J. Okafor-Lindt, V. Strand, H. Mavery. Quick session on the new Summit tier. Everyone's happy with the feature split and the launch window in early spring. Pricing lands between current plans, no grandfathering issues expected. Board to see full deck next month. Reasoning on positioning is captured in the confidential note below.

board note of tafop-bahap: Only 9 of the 80 pilot accounts renewed Ralael, so a churn review is set for April 1.

- [ ] **Step 7: Breaker override escrow.** After sealing the signing keys for the Tallgrove upstream API circuit breaker, confirm the support team can force the breaker open during a full outage. The override bundle lives in the sealed escrow drawer and is useless without its unlock phrase. Two ceremony witnesses must initial this step before proceeding. The escrow bundle is decrypted with the recovery passphrase that follows.

vault phrase of kahip-kahop = holath-quenmir